Rent a boat without a license in Olbia, Italy

If you don’t have a boating permit, you can still rent a boat without a license in Olbia, Italy. This is a great way to experience the beauty of the sea without any special training. Whether you want to swim, sunbathe, or cruise along the shore, there are plenty of options available.

In Olbia, Italy, you’ll find various types of boats that are available for rent without license, depending on the kind of adventure you’re seeking. RIB are in high demand in this destination. But you'll also find:

  • 4 motorboats
  • 89 RIB

How much does it cost to rent a boat in Olbia, Italy?

Boat rental prices in Olbia, Italy depend on various factors, including the boat’s type, size, and the length of the rental period. Seasonal demand and additional services can also affect the final cost.

Starting at $141,13, you can access the lowest prices for boat rentals. For a more typical experience, you can expect to pay an average of $243,45 per day.

Renting a boat for a group: how many can board?

Rental boats have different capacities depending on their size, type, and safety equipment. In Olbia, Italy, the maximum number of passengers varies between 4 and 11, depending on the listing.

What is the best time of year to rent a boat in Olbia, Italy?

The best time for a boat rental in Olbia, Italy is during the peak season between June - August when the weather is warm and the conditions are ideal for sailing. The average water temperature is around 24–28°C, making it ideal for swimming and water sports. If you prefer a more relaxed atmosphere, the shoulder seasons in May and September offer pleasant temperatures and fewer crowds. This period still offers excellent boating conditions for a quiet and enjoyable experience. No matter when you choose to rent, Olbia, Italy promises stunning landscapes and unforgettable moments on the water.

The best place to go boating in Olbia, Italy

Sailing in Olbia, Italy offers a variety of amazing places to visit. Some of the most popular spots include Costa Smeralda, La Maddalena Archipelago, Porto Cervo., which offer great boating conditions. Whether you're planning a relaxing day on the water or an extended trip, there are plenty of options. Wherever you go, Olbia, Italy is a perfect sailing destination.
